British Pound
The official currency of the United Kingdom, which is one of the world's major currencies traded on foreign exchange markets.
Canadian Dollar
The official currency of Canada, symbolized as CAD or $, and commonly used in international financial transactions.
Fixed Exchange Rate System
A currency valuation system where the value of a currency is pegged to the value of another currency, a basket of currencies, or another measure of value.
Floating Rate System
A currency exchange rate policy in which a currency's value is allowed to fluctuate in response to foreign-exchange market mechanisms without direct intervention by the country's central bank.
